How big does Blackblotch lizardfish get?
Blackblotch lizardfish can grow up to 20.0 cm long.
Where is Blackblotch lizardfish found?
Coral reefs
What family does Blackblotch lizardfish belong to?
Blackblotch lizardfish (Synodus jaculum) belongs to the family Synodontidae (Lizardfishes) in the order Aulopiformes (Lizardfishes & Allies).
